These 3D models are created from the information provided by the patient’s own CT scans of the affected areas. An advantage of Three-dimensional models is that they identify defects that 2-D images do not, which helps the surgeon do a better job. These models are not rough ideas, they are exact replica models of a patient’s spine and accurate to within 1/35th of a millimeter. This is a critical innovation as it gives the physician the opportunity to actually hold this replica of the Scoliosis and Kyphosis spine in their hand and allows them the opportunity to do a pre-surgery evaluation and practice the technique prior to actual surgery.

These models can be used to help the surgeon explain to you in detail exactly what they are seeing and exactly what will happen during your treatment for Scoliosis.
Orthpaedic Physicians who are already using the 3-D models in their own practices are very pleased with the advantages they are experiencing over 2-D imagery. There is a cost reduction to patients of tens of thousands of dollars due to total Scoliosis and Kyphosis surgery time being reduced 10-15% since the Surgeons have the ability to practice the surgery beforehand. There has also been a reduction in patient recovery time since the surgeon can locate potential problems ahead of time and plan for them. Patient care can also be optimized now that everyone involved can be made aware of exactly what can be expected and prepared for.
